On May 14, 2026, the College of Politics and Government (Ranong Education Center) led students to participate in a moral and ethics training activity to honor the institution of the monarchy through religious perspectives.

On Thursday, May 14, 2026, from 9:00 a.m. to 12:00 p.m., the College of Politics and Government (Ranong Education Center) led regular program students to participate in a moral and ethics training activity to honor the institution of the monarchy through religious perspectives. The activity was held in celebration of the birthday anniversary of His Royal Highness Prince Dipangkorn Rasmijoti Mahavajirotamangkun Sirivibulyarajakumar on April 29, 2026. The event was organized by the Ranong Provincial Cultural Office at Suan Sunandha Rajabhat University, Ranong Education Center.

On this occasion, Police Lieutenant Colonel Kritsana Jannit, Head of the Political Science Program, and Ms. Thida Nitithornyada, Head of the Law Program, assigned Mr. Phuchit Phurisirikul, Lecturer in the Law Program, and Mr. Pannarasm Tiwanat, Lecturer in the Political Science Program (Ranong Education Center), to participate in the activity.
